Output 433361b610815edce64ad29fc608074d5f7dc1233b0e2efe9c9c15111a48bb17:10

value
1883573557
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ac50473af6a7c172ea39503303627f4c1f08607c OP_EQUALVERIFY OP_CHECKSIG
address
1Gi7PprDHuuGdk6YQc8VVo6K1HhdHjoyTF
transaction
433361b610815edce64ad29fc608074d5f7dc1233b0e2efe9c9c15111a48bb17
spent
true